Abstract


Viral marketing techniques are powerful channels for organizations to reach their target groups since they give an opportunity to spread the marketing messages very fast to a lot of people. In this study, viral marketing techniques, supported by different cases, are emphasized and the viral mediums on the web platform such as e-mailing, advergaming, and consumer generated media, weblogging, videologging and mobilelogging are highlighted. A virtual community is a precious information collation source allowing a company to identify conditions on which to base bubble information and indications regarding the time and manner on which the bubble should be triggered. Observations of virtual community dynamics, people entering and exiting, the length of their stay and so on, are fertile indicators for bubble potential in terms of dimension and timeframe. By viral marketing techniques marketers can reach their consumers by using their imaginations, creativity and interactivity. The article attempts to explore bubbles in online marketing industry from various perspectives to determine whether it is going to be a successful business model or a bubble which would burst burning millions of investor funds. In the first segment the parameters that are driving the growth are discussed followed by the pitfalls that could derail the online marketing is discussed.
